A group of impostors posing as Trump supporters, waving neo-Nazi flags, found themselves drenched with water by outraged Republicans during a MAGA boat parade in Jupiter, Florida.
The event, held on Sunday, is a recurring gathering of Trump supporters who have rallied at the same harbor since 2020 to show their support for the presidential candidate, as reported by the Daily Mail.
Videos quickly surfaced online, revealing a boat filled with men dressed in swastika-emblazoned shirts, shouting racist slurs, and holding up Nazi symbols.

Trump supporters were quick to distance themselves, labeling the group as “infiltrators” and accusing them of being “dirty Dems doing their usual plants.” Many of the attendees made it clear that these provocateurs were not welcome.
The neo-Nazi group, reportedly uninvited, disrupted the parade, hurling anti-Semitic comments and shouting, “Heil Trump,” “Make America White Again,” and “White Power.”
Their presence was far from the patriotism and Christian values that the event had promoted. Some of these individuals also waved swastika and Trump flags, further inflaming the crowd’s anger.
The Trump supporters didn't take kindly to the hate-filled messages. One viral video captured the group of neo-Nazis heckling another boat decorated with American and Trump flags.

The Trump-supporting boat retaliated, shooting water at the intruders, causing their boat to swerve. A passenger on the targeted boat could be heard shouting, “Ha, you f**king pu**y,” while flipping the bird to the infiltrators.

Supporters flocked to the video online, praising the Trump boaters for standing up to the troublemakers. Comments flooded in with messages like, “I watched this too many times. Nobody hates those a**holes more than Trump supporters,” and “I wouldn’t have stopped until their boat was flooded.”
The event organizer later explained, "The patriots would not put up with this, so we handled it the best we could until the Palm Beach Marine Patrol arrived and detained them." The boat's Florida registration numbers were visible, and efforts are underway to identify the infiltrators.
